When it comes to setting up an EV Charger Installation Sydney, selecting the right hardware is crucial, as different vehicles and electrical systems require special requirements. Usually, homes in New South Wales have single-phase power, which can deal with standard fast-charging devices that provide a complete charge overnight. Nevertheless, for households with three-phase power or numerous electric cars, a more advanced EV Charger Installation Sydney can considerably decrease charging times. To ensure a safe and efficient setup, certified installers should examine the home's switchboard capability to prevent overloading the electrical system, which could result in tripped circuits and safety risks. A thorough technical evaluation is crucial to ensure compliance with regional electrical codes, prevent prospective threats, and keep a reputable and effective charging procedure.
